How to buy and sell usdt

To purchase USDT, create an account on a reputable cryptocurrency exchange like Binance, deposit funds into your account, and place a buy order for USDT on the trading platform.

Step 1: Understand the Concept of USDT

USDT (Tether) is a stablecoin, a type of cryptocurrency pegged to a fiat currency, specifically the US dollar. Each USDT represents one US dollar, and its value fluctuates minimal compared to other cryptocurrencies. This stability makes USDT popular for stable value transactions, remittances, and as a hedge against volatility in the crypto market.

Step 2: Choose a Reputable Exchange

Select a cryptocurrency exchange that supports USDT trading. Look for reputable exchanges with high trading volumes, a strong security record, and favorable trading fees. Some notable exchanges include Binance, Coinbase, and KuCoin.

Step 3: Create an Account and Verify Your Identity

Open an account with the chosen exchange by providing personal information, email address, and phone number. Complete identity verification by submitting government-issued identification and often an additional proof of residency. This process ensures compliance with anti-money laundering (AML) and know-your-customer (KYC) regulations.

Step 4: Deposit Funds into Your Account

Fund your account with fiat currency to purchase USDT. Most exchanges offer multiple methods, including bank transfers, credit/debit cards, and third-party payment providers. Choose the option that suits you best based on convenience, fees, and processing time.

Step 5: Buy USDT

Once your account is funded, navigate to the exchange's trading platform. Search for USDT trading pair, such as BTC/USDT or ETH/USDT. Place a buy order specifying the amount of USDT you wish to purchase and the price you are willing to pay. Once the order matches with a seller, the USDT will be credited to your account.

Step 6: Store Your USDT Securely

Once you own USDT, store it securely to protect against theft or loss. You can store it on the exchange's wallet, which is convenient but may be subject to security risks. Alternatively, you can create a non-custodial wallet like MetaMask or Trust Wallet, providing greater control and security over your funds.

Step 7: Sell USDT

To sell USDT, follow the same process in reverse. Place a sell order on the exchange's trading platform, specifying the amount you want to sell and the desired price. Once the order matches with a buyer, the USDT will be transferred out of your account, and you will receive the proceeds in the fiat currency or cryptocurrency of your choice.

FAQs:

  • How is USDT different from other cryptocurrencies?

USDT is a stablecoin, while most other cryptocurrencies experience significant price fluctuations. This stability makes USDT ideal for preserving value and stable value transactions.

  • How do I withdraw USDT from an exchange?

To withdraw USDT from an exchange, navigate to the withdrawal page, provide the recipient's wallet address, specify the amount to withdraw, and complete any additional security measures required.

  • What are the fees associated with buying and selling USDT?

Transaction fees and other associated costs vary depending on the exchange used. Check the fee schedule of the exchange before making any trades.

  • Is it safe to store USDT on an exchange?

Storing USDT on an exchange can be convenient but introduces security risks due to potential hacks and vulnerabilities. For enhanced security, consider storing your USDT in a non-custodial wallet that provides you with complete control over your funds.
